The recipe says to refrigerate the dough overnight.
The last couple times I didn't and liked the texture of the cookies better this way.

If you do use cold dough the cookies turn out a little chubbier though.

Both results are chewy and delicious and perfect with milk (or coffee) on a snowy day!
